Kody Clemens doubled home two in the fifth and singled home the winner in the seventh — three RBI on a night when the Twins needed all of them. Taj Bradley struck out seven over five and left with a lead Kody Funderburk surrendered in a third of an inning — three hits, three earned. AJ Smith-Shawver walked three and gave up four in four and a third, and Atlanta kept coming: Acuña, Thomas, and Albies each drove in a run. But Brooks Lee's single in the seventh restored the edge, and Yoendrys Gómez closed it on 13 pitches.
